Distance From Bloomington-Normal Airport to Menominee Airport (BMI - MNM Distance)

The flight distance from Bloomington-Normal Airport (BMI) to Menominee Airport (MNM) is 328 miles. This is equivalent to 528 kilometers or 285 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.

Flight Duration between Bloomington-Normal, United States and Menominee, United States

Estimated flight time from Bloomington-Normal Airport, Bloomington-Normal, United States to Menominee Airport, Menominee, United States is 0 hours 39 minutes under avarage conditions. The fl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ind speeds or weather conditions.
